Any modern military worth its weight maintains a healthy collection of combat-proven aircraft.
Air forces serve as one component of a three-pronged approach when waging war (Land-Sea-Air). Used in conjunction with other services, air power is critical to subduing enemy elements on the ground and at sea. The major powers of the world currently hold in inventory thousands of combat aircraft of various types with the United States Air Force (USAF) leading the way as the largest air service on the globe.
